About Archiving a Menu
You can archive a "My Menu" menu (i.e., a menu owned by your account). When you archive a menu it does not appear on the Menus Listing screen.
It is recommended to archive menus that are currently inactive. For example, if there is a special event menu used for a holiday once a year, then you can keep it archived until the appropriate time next year.
Archiving a "My Menu" Menu
To archive a "My Menu" menu:
- Select Menus > Menus Listing. The Menus Listing screen appears, displaying menus owned by your account.
- For the menu you want to archive, click its gear icon in the Actions column and select Archive.
- A confirmation message appears stating that the menu is archived, and the menu disappears from the Menus Listing screen. Note that if the menu had been active, it is now inactive.
Unarchiving a "My Menu" Menu
To unarchive a "My Menu" menu that has been archived, complete the following steps:
- Select Menus > Menus Listing. The Menus Listing screen appears, displaying menus owned by your account.
- To display archived menus on the Menus Listing screen:
- Expand the Filters section at the top of the screen.
- From the Menu Status field, select Archived.
- Click GO to display the archived menus.
A menu that is archived appears on the Menus Listing screen with the status of Archived, as per screenshot below.
- To unarchive an archived menu, click its gear icon in the Actions column and select Unarchive.
- A confirmation message appears stating that the menu has been unarchived, and the menu shows on the Menus Listing screen with the status of Inactive, as per screenshot below.
